Selecting the Best Hinges

Hinges are often overlooked as a key component of the door's function. They help to ensure that doors open and close effortlessly. They also provide a variety of security features, including tamper-resistance and stopping unwanted removal from the frame. They come in a variety of styles and materials, therefore it's important to choose the right hinge that meets your requirements.

If you own a uPVC Composite Door, it might require hinges that differ from a conventional uPVC Door. This is because composite doors offer better weather resistance, insulation, security, and durability. In addition, they are designed to complement the aesthetic of your home, making them an excellent choice for modern homes.

The hinges you choose will ensure that your door shuts and opens correctly and that there aren't any issues such as draughts or leaks. The key to this is to ensure that the hinges are correctly aligned. You can achieve this by adjusting the screws on the hinges or using the fix jig.

The type of hinges that you require will be determined by the type and size of your door. There are three primary types: rebated, T, and flag hinges. Flag hinges attach to the frame of the door. T hinges fit in a rebate, and rebated are affixed to the frame. The kind of hinge you need will depend on the dimensions and style of your door, the degree of flexibility you want and the way it will be employed.

The screws on the hinges for the flag can be adjusted for the height and depth of the doors, while the T hinges can move the door both horizontally and vertically. You can use an Allen key to adjust these settings. Be sure to adjust the hinge at all three points to make sure the door is straight and aligned to the frame. A hinge with a rebate can be adjusted by loosening screws on the sides of the frame to allow lateral movement.

Getting Started

Maintaining your upvc hinges in good condition and maintaining them regularly can help ensure that they continue to work smoothly. Cleaning the hinges and lubricating them is part of this. Also, make sure they are aligned properly. Regular maintenance can eliminate draughts, gaps and other energy-wasting components around the door.

How to maintain your hinges will depend on the kind of uPVC you have. If you aren't sure about the kind of uPVC hinges for your door, you can ask the manufacturer or a professional uPVC installation.

The majority of uPVC door frames and doors are equipped with adjustable flag or T-hinges that ensure the best alignment and placement of the door. In most cases the adjustment is done without the need to remove the hinges from the door or frame. It is essential to use a spirit-level to determine the gap at the top, middle and bottom of the frame and the door. If the gap is different, it is necessary to adjust the casement window hinge replacement height accordingly.

If you're unhappy with the results of your uPVC door hinges adjustments It could be time to think about replacing them. It's a good idea to look online and high street specialist outlets to see what prices are available for new uPVC hinges and what options are available in terms of features, quality and performance.

Another common problem that uPVC doors can face is warping. This is due to the extreme weather conditions that can cause damage on the materials. uPVC can expand and change shape in extreme cold conditions. This can cause the door to fall on the floor, or allow drafts to enter through the gap at bottom of the frame.

Fortunately, this is an easy fix and can be fixed by tightening the hinges with a compression adjustment screw. This screw is usually located on the hinge. Based on the design, it may be at the top or the bottom. After the screw has been tightened, you can attach the hinge to the frame and door.

Installation

It is essential to check and adjust the hinges frequently the same way you would with the door. This will ensure that your uPVC patio door functions correctly. This will ensure that the door closes smoothly and keeps water and moisture out of the house and stops draughts from entering.

Before you can begin making adjustments, it's crucial to understand what kind of hinge you're using. There are three kinds of hinges that include flag hinges, T hinges and rebate hinges. Most modern uPVC door hinges come with an open hinge that allows you to adjust your door both horizontally and vertically. T hinges also allow the lateral adjustment. Butt hinges, which are more prevalent on older uPVC doors, will not permit adjustments in the lateral direction.

Make use of a fixing jig when installing the new uPVC sash or hinge plate to mark the location of screw holes. The jig lets you drill your hinge plate in advance which makes the process quicker and more accurate. After the screws have been tightened, you will need to add packers to hold the sash to prevent damage to the frame and uPVC profiles.

Depending on what type of uPVC patio doors you own the steps to install the hinges will vary. The process for fitting hinges is exact same for all. Once the holes are drilled and the hinges are fixed using the drill that is cordless.

After the hinges are fitted, you can alter the compression by adding shims, or taking them off. This can be done by loosening the screw at the bottom hinge and turning it several times to observe the differences, and then adjusting the hinge's position in increments.

After you have determined what kind of hinge you have and the way to adjust it you can examine the other components of the door. Check to see if everything is functioning properly. Once you have your uPVC doors aligned and positioned, it is easier to adjust the roller points, draught strip or the strike of the lock.

Maintenance

Upvc doors, just like other things, require maintenance to function properly. This could include a yearly check cleaning, lubrication, as well as adjustments to hinges and locks. If there are any issues that are discovered like a drafty door or a sticky lock, it is essential to fix them promptly and professionally to prevent further damage or expense.

It is crucial to know the kind of hinges you will find on your doors made of upvc in order to adjust them correctly. Most frames made of upvc use hinges that are 'flag' or butt. These hinges are commonly used on older door frames, and are difficult to adjust for the user. With an Allen key and a screwdriver, you can make adjustments to the vertical and horizontal alignments of a door made of upvc. The adjustment points are typically located inside the hinge plates and will be marked with an "H". You can also test the gap between the door and frame to ensure that it is level and not uneven or catchy.

The most frequent problems with hinges for patio doors made of upvc result from wear and tear as well as improper installation. Most of these problems can be resolved with simple DIY fixes and regular maintenance.

It's important to regularly clean the seals on upvc doors because dirt, grime and other contaminants can harm the gaskets made of rubber, and reduce the performance. Cleaning your upvc doors and sealing them is best done with a soft, damp cloth and soapy water. It is also an excellent idea to schedule regular maintenance so that any problems can be dealt with immediately before they become worse. This includes the regular lubrication of moving parts and cleaning of the gaskets to prevent condensation and buildup of moisture.
